The president of one of the companies said the utility’s leaders had taken a “scorched earth, take no prisoners, Sherman’s march to the sea” decision-making approach.

High waters at Eklutna Lake are seen on Aug. 29, 2023. Anchorage’s water utility and a group of bottled water companies are in a dispute over the bottlers’ access to the utility’s treatment plant near the lake.

That’s where the bottling companies can currently fill their tanker trucks with water that’s been disinfected but not yet chlorinated and fluorinated.saying The utility says that bottled water businesses could still use glacier water from city hydrants — after the utility has fluorinated and chlorinated it. But the businesses — including one existing bottler and multiple companies hoping to bottle in the future — have , saying that the addition of the chemicals would change the water’s taste and damage their sales.
